This weekend we finally adopted our second piggie. His name is Radar and he is about 2-2.5 years old and around 3 pounds! He was neutered about a month ago, so is safe for my girl to be around.
We decided not to quarantine him only because both he and my pig have been to the vet within last month and been given clean bills of health and before you adopt she likes to do introductions there to make sure they get along (assuming both parties are healthy). Doing intros there negated the whole purpose of quarantine. Had we not been positive on either one's health status, we would have seperated them for the appropriate time.
